Carpal tunnel syndrome, long understood as a condition shaped by repetitive motion and anatomy, may also be quietly worsened by what we eat — and not in the same way for everyone. A new study published in Nature reveals that high-fat diets activate fibrotic genes in the connective tissue of the wrist, accelerating the very scarring process that compresses the median nerve, while doing so along distinctly different biological pathways in males and females.
